Output 61fb0be71ccedec2ba64b7fb0d73214727b458cd0d98c0caebca571056835594:0

value
370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b003be7e6462b18e25864aec3e769fbf0946a00 OP_EQUAL
address
374z57xpT9x6MaBv37KNmFJPBJJsS8d1Qw
transaction
61fb0be71ccedec2ba64b7fb0d73214727b458cd0d98c0caebca571056835594
confirmations
170835
spent
true